About Organization
Women's Protective Services operates emergency shelter, counseling, legal advocacy, and prevention programs for domestic violence survivors and their children. Based in Lubbock, TX, the organization operates with 43 employees and $3.5 million in annual revenue. The agency provides 24-hour crisis intervention, transitional housing, and community education addressing domestic violence in West Texas.

Form 990 data showing organizational financial health and growth.
Revenue (2023)
$3.3M
+13% vs 2022
Expenses (2023)
$3.4M
+21.1% vs 2022
Assets (2023)
$2.3M
-1.2% vs 2022
Employees (2023)
45
-19.6% vs 2022
| Year | Revenue | Expenses | Assets | Employees |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2023 | $3,316,170 | $3,385,221 | $2,278,803 | 45 |
| 2022 | $2,933,911 | $2,795,048 | $2,305,898 | 56 |
| 2021 | $2,759,154 | $2,934,210 | $2,119,444 | 52 |
| 2020 | $3,051,165 | $2,724,857 | $2,373,937 | 52 |
| 2019 | $2,481,311 | $2,664,854 | $2,330,981 | 54 |
| 2018 | $2,406,385 | $2,377,028 | $2,227,744 | 52 |
| 2017 | $2,258,159 | $2,214,211 | $2,199,842 | 48 |
Source: IRS Form 990 filings. All figures in USD.
